Lot Description:

Inspired by the most precious marbles from all over Italy and Europe, the Impero Collection blends classic and contemporary styles, creating a transitional design that is warm and polished. Elegant textures and colors are produced with the highest standards of quality and detail to meet modern design needs.This high-performance marble-effect porcelain tile is resistant to wear and stains. This tile also offers an ease to cleaning and sanitizing using common household detergents.

  • 15.50 sq. ft./Case; 2 Tiles/Case; 55.04 lb./Case
  • 24 in. width x 48 in. length x 0.375 in. thick
  • Grade 1, first-quality porcelain tile for walls of tremendous aesthetic impact, characterized by spectacular contrasts of light and shadow sculpted by an elegant lighting that exalts or softens the surface depth.
  • Glazed, smooth finish with low sheen and moderate variation in tone.
  • Suitable for both residential and commercial use.
  • Class 4 abrasion resistance (medium to heavy traffic) - suitable for all residential applications (both walls and floors), as well as medium commercial and light institutional locations.
  • Truly waterproof - porcelain flooring has water absorption of less than 0.5%, and it is suitable for indoor or outdoor use.
  • Completely frost resistant for indoor and outdoor applications. We recommend using a modified thin set when outdoor, according to the manufacturer.
  • Slip resistance DCOF greater than or equal to 0.42 - all Corso Italia tiles meet ANSI requirements for use on level interior or exterior floors expected to be walked upon when wet (not recommended for outdoor wet areas such as pools, where we recommend higher slip resistance - check out Corso Italia porcelain pavers).
  • It is recommended you purchase a minimum of 10% overage to account for design cuts and patterns. Before you begin an installation, familiarize yourself with cost factors.  This Project Cost Guide can assist you in budgeting for your tile project.
  • Please ensure that all tile needed for a project is obtained within 1 order - multiple orders can result in receiving multiple dye lots and/or calibers, related to different production batches, which may slightly vary.
  • Overlap during installation should not exceed 33% (a third of the tile length), 50% overlap not recommended.
  • Made from natural ingredients, free from allergens, VOCs, formaldehyde and PVC. It is naturally inhospitable to bacteria and stain resistant - regular household cleaning will keep surface clean and sanitized.
